Goalkeeper training requires an unique and highly specialized method, as the position demands a different skill set contrasted to outfield athletes. Sessions often focus on reaction development, shot-stopping strategies, and positioning, helping goalkeepers respond rapidly to unexpected situations. Drills such as diving saves, grasping practice, and head-to-head scenarios are essential for building confidence and steadiness. Mobility is a further vital component, enabling goalkeepers to traverse efficiently across the goal and maintain stability. Also, passing skills—both tossing and kicking—are emphasized to help commence offensives from the back. Dialogue is also an essential obligation, as goalkeepers need to organize their defense and provide clear commands during matches.

As players progress, training becomes increasingly specialized, focusing on strategic understanding and game insight. Small-sided matches are a favored method to imitate genuine match scenarios, encouraging quick decision-making and teamwork. During these sessions, athletes work on precision in passing and spatial awareness, learning how to utilize openings in the opposition's defense. Coaches may additionally design drills that mimic specific in-game dynamics, such as counterattacks or defensive shifts. Alongside these tactical components, speed and agility drills play a critical role in improving response time and mobility efficiency. This comprehensive method guarantees athletes are not only technically skilled but also capable of adapting to the dynamic nature of challenging games.
